Searched refs:wait_list (Results 1 – 13 of 13) sorted by relevance
| /drivers/gpu/drm/omapdrm/ |
| A D | omap_irq.c | 27 list_for_each_entry(wait, &priv->wait_list, node) in omap_irq_update() 53 list_add(&wait->node, &priv->wait_list); in omap_irq_wait_init() 240 list_for_each_entry_safe(wait, n, &priv->wait_list, node) { in omap_irq_handler() 265 INIT_LIST_HEAD(&priv->wait_list); in omap_drm_irq_install()
|
| A D | omap_drv.h | 96 struct list_head wait_list; /* list of omap_irq_wait */ member
|
| /drivers/nvme/target/ |
| A D | rdma.c | 79 struct list_head wait_list; member 522 struct nvmet_rdma_rsp, wait_list); in nvmet_rdma_process_wr_wait_list() 523 list_del(&rsp->wait_list); in nvmet_rdma_process_wr_wait_list() 530 list_add(&rsp->wait_list, &queue->rsp_wr_wait_list); in nvmet_rdma_process_wr_wait_list() 988 list_add_tail(&cmd->wait_list, &queue->rsp_wr_wait_list); in nvmet_rdma_handle_command() 1012 list_add_tail(&rsp->wait_list, &queue->rsp_wait_list); in nvmet_rdma_recv_not_live() 1645 struct nvmet_rdma_rsp, wait_list); in nvmet_rdma_queue_established() 1646 list_del(&cmd->wait_list); in nvmet_rdma_queue_established() 1672 wait_list); in __nvmet_rdma_queue_disconnect() 1673 list_del(&rsp->wait_list); in __nvmet_rdma_queue_disconnect()
|
| /drivers/infiniband/ulp/rtrs/ |
| A D | rtrs-srv.h | 58 struct list_head wait_list; member
|
| A D | rtrs-srv.c | 517 list_add_tail(&id->wait_list, &con->rsp_wr_wait_list); in rtrs_srv_resp_rdma() 1205 struct rtrs_srv_op, wait_list); in rtrs_rdma_process_wr_wait_list() 1206 list_del(&id->wait_list); in rtrs_rdma_process_wr_wait_list() 1213 list_add(&id->wait_list, &con->rsp_wr_wait_list); in rtrs_rdma_process_wr_wait_list()
|
| /drivers/net/ethernet/qlogic/qlcnic/ |
| A D | qlcnic_sriov_common.c | 195 INIT_LIST_HEAD(&vf->rcv_act.wait_list); in qlcnic_sriov_init() 196 INIT_LIST_HEAD(&vf->rcv_pend.wait_list); in qlcnic_sriov_init() 247 while (!list_empty(&t_list->wait_list)) { in qlcnic_sriov_cleanup_list() 248 trans = list_first_entry(&t_list->wait_list, in qlcnic_sriov_cleanup_list() 1067 trans = list_first_entry(&vf->rcv_act.wait_list, in qlcnic_sriov_process_bc_cmd() 1127 list_add_tail(&trans->list, &t_list->wait_list); in __qlcnic_sriov_add_act_list() 1159 list_for_each(node, &vf->rcv_pend.wait_list) { in qlcnic_sriov_handle_pending_trans() 1260 list_add_tail(&trans->list, &vf->rcv_pend.wait_list); in qlcnic_sriov_handle_bc_cmd()
|
| A D | qlcnic_sriov.h | 61 struct list_head wait_list; member
|
| /drivers/infiniband/core/ |
| A D | mad.c | 416 INIT_LIST_HEAD(&mad_agent_priv->wait_list); in ib_register_mad_agent() 1140 &mad_agent_priv->wait_list) { in handle_wait_state() 1150 list_item = &mad_agent_priv->wait_list; in handle_wait_state() 1943 list_for_each_entry(wr, &mad_agent_priv->wait_list, agent_list) { in ib_find_send_mad() 2411 if (list_empty(&mad_agent_priv->wait_list)) { in adjust_timeout() 2414 mad_send_wr = list_entry(mad_agent_priv->wait_list.next, in adjust_timeout() 2440 if (mad_agent_priv->wait_list.next == &mad_send_wr->agent_list) in wait_for_response() 2667 &mad_agent_priv->wait_list, agent_list) { in cancel_mads() 2689 list_for_each_entry(mad_send_wr, &mad_agent_priv->wait_list, in find_send_wr() 2890 while (!list_empty(&mad_agent_priv->wait_list)) { in timeout_sends() [all …]
|
| A D | mad_priv.h | 99 struct list_head wait_list; member
|
| /drivers/infiniband/ulp/srpt/ |
| A D | ib_srpt.h | 185 struct list_head wait_list; member
|
| A D | ib_srpt.c | 1710 if (!list_empty(&recv_ioctx->wait_list)) { in srpt_handle_new_iu() 1712 list_del_init(&recv_ioctx->wait_list); in srpt_handle_new_iu() 1747 if (list_empty(&recv_ioctx->wait_list)) { in srpt_handle_new_iu() 1749 list_add_tail(&recv_ioctx->wait_list, &ch->cmd_wait_list); in srpt_handle_new_iu() 1791 wait_list) { in srpt_process_wait_list() 2358 INIT_LIST_HEAD(&ch->ioctx_recv_ring[i]->wait_list); in srpt_cm_req_recv() 3157 INIT_LIST_HEAD(&sdev->ioctx_ring[i]->wait_list); in srpt_alloc_srq() 3406 WARN_ON_ONCE(!list_empty(&recv_ioctx->wait_list)); in srpt_release_cmd()
|
| /drivers/md/ |
| A D | dm-integrity.c | 231 struct list_head wait_list; member 1213 list_for_each_entry(range, &ic->wait_list, wait_entry) { in add_new_range() 1242 while (unlikely(!list_empty(&ic->wait_list))) { in remove_range_unlocked() 1244 list_first_entry(&ic->wait_list, struct dm_integrity_range, wait_entry); in remove_range_unlocked() 1251 list_add(&last_range->wait_entry, &ic->wait_list); in remove_range_unlocked() 1271 list_add_tail(&new_range->wait_entry, &ic->wait_list); in wait_and_add_new_range() 4541 INIT_LIST_HEAD(&ic->wait_list); in dm_integrity_ctr() 5162 BUG_ON(!list_empty(&ic->wait_list)); in dm_integrity_dtr()
|
| /drivers/acpi/ |
| A D | osl.c | 1260 BUG_ON(!list_empty(&sem->wait_list)); in acpi_os_delete_semaphore()
|
Completed in 52 milliseconds